A homicide investigation has been launched after a person died in a South Auckland shooting early this morning.
Police were called to the scene on Beatty Street, Ōtāhuhu, at about 2.15am, Acting Detective Inspector Warrick Adkin said today in a statement.
The person was found with critical injuries and died at the scene.
"We are speaking to witnesses and conducting a scene examination today," Adkin said.
"Residents in the area can expect to see a continued police presence as we work to understand the circumstances and ensure the community’s safety."
Beatty Street remains cordoned off.
